tortexal 10-23-2007, 10:39 AM the 14815 will not work on anything with out custom fabrication bc its a universal muffler
the 14815 will not work on anything with out custom fabrication bc its a universal muffler
ok. Explains cheapness. The whole setup w/ custom fab would still be way cheeper than getting a Remus or something like that.

tortexal 10-30-2007, 04:45 PM well, in the day ive had it do far it seems to have quieted down a bit. my buddy siad the magnaflows will quiet down and get deeper as they break in. i just hope my performance wasnt effected by going from 2 pipes to 1. the shop said it wouldnt at all bc the stock muffler is so restrictive and the magnaflow is straight through. its just weird hearing exhaust all the time now vs hearing the engine. I'm used to hearing where peak power is based on engine noise and now hearing the exhaust throws me off.

Fleksta 11-12-2007, 06:16 PM Just had this same setup installed on my 525 today. Damn its loud! Sounds awesome when getting on the throttle. Just cruising around at about 2k-2.5k rpm though there is a deep bass droning that is kind of annoying. I hope it drops off when the muffler gets broken in. Again though, I love the sound when its revving and higher in the rpm range.
Tortexal, does your setup have that droning down in the low rpm range? I can see it getting very unbearable for longer trips.
tortexal 11-12-2007, 06:30 PM it'll quiet down in about a week. will drone a bit at low rpms but i dont do any road trips besides huge crises and w/ those we're driving pretty hard. if you like how it sounds now just wait until its broken in. it sounds much better imo
